Document Summary
The MIL-PRF-32725 document titled "Fire Extinguishing Agent, Fluorine-Free Foam (F3) Liquid Concentrate, for Land-Based, Fresh Water Applications" governs the use of fluorine-free foam (F3) liquid concentrate fire extinguishing agents. These agents are specifically designed for use on class B hydrocarbon liquid fuel fires in land-based applications. The document is approved for use by all Departments and Agencies of the Department of Defense. The F3 agents are not intended for use on polar solvents or for U.S. Navy shipboard use. The concentrates are to be diluted with fresh water at the time of use to form a foam solution. The document also covers additional requirements for mis-proportioned foam solutions.
